Online University Highlight of the Week
"With over 950 online courses offered each year and 40 plus programs of study at the certificate, associate, bachelor, and master's degree level, The University of Toledo has the courses and programs to fit into your busy schedule."
UT was originally established in 1872 and "provides award-winning online classes to students worldwide." UT's main campus is located in Toledo, Ohio. The University of Toledo is regionally accredited by the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ools. Below is a partial list of programs delivered online by UT:
- A.A. in Accounting Technology
- A.A. in Marketing and Sales Technology
- A.A. in Technical Studies
- B.A. in Interdisciplinary Studies
- B.A. in Liberal Studies
- B.S. in Health Information Management
- B.S. in Nursing, RN to BSN
- M.Ed. in Early Childhood Education
- M.S. in Engineering
- M.S. in Nursing - Nurse Educator
Comparing Schools
What is the difference between private and public schools? And what about for-profit and nonprofit? Is there a difference in quality?
Before you start researching schools, there are some key terms to know. For example, the main difference between a private institution and a public institution is funding. To help offset the cost of operation, public colleges and universities receive state funding. Private colleges and universities do not receive state funds, and rely instead on other sources, such as endowments and tuition fees.
Nonprofit schools are organizations that have legally established themselves as providing education without turning a profit. For-profit schools are organizations where they are able to turn a profit.
Though it may not have any bearing on the quality of education, it is important to be aware of the different types of institutions. Knowing how a school manages its operations may give you a clue as to how you may be treated once you enroll. Read more about the types of online education providers.
